Abstract(englisch):
Education is generally coupled with very high expectations, on the individual level as much as regarding sozio-economical development. In contrary the article discuss some unintended and potentially problematic consequences of education such as its influence on marriage decisions and social exclusion. Starting from observations in India, research results on the conherency between formal education and the decision for a marriage partner in Germany will be discussed.
